The process is pretty simple. Firstly you take a civil servant test. The higher you score the better chance you have making it into the second phase. Usually there are three bands of results for the test - and the scoring is weighed on how many people took the test. In my case I case off of 5114 in 1986 - I scored a 92.6, placing me in band two, 2/5 of a point from making band one. One the list is gathered notifications for the first few thousand are mailed and you're ready to start your next phase - the investigation. You report to a facility named by the department - mine was in the court house in downtown Manhattan. Here you are given the information you will need to get hired. A quick eye test, and hours of hearing Horror stories from seasoned officers - this is done to see if you have the stomach - don't be surprised to see people leaving in flocks.

At the end of the day you return home, and start your application packet - this packet is then brought to the Applicant Investigation Unit. You'll be assigned an investigator. As the investigation proceeds you'll be scheduled for a Psychological exam, both written and oral, as well as a medical exam (12 hours). Once this is complete and you pass the aforementioned, you are cleared for the academy. You are usually notified 4-5 days before the academy. You need to attend a mini-medical to make sure your urine is clean, and you have no broken bones. Around three days later, you begin the academy. Six month later you are a full-fledged PPO (Probationary Police Officer).
